Section 14 β€” Standing orders

Subject to the provisions of this Act, the Board may regulate its own procedure by standing orders, and without prejudice to the generality of the foregoing, the Board may make standing orders in respect of the following matters, that is to sayβ€”

(a) the proper conduct of business and meetings of the Board;

(b) the method of entering into and execution of contracts;

(c) the signing of cheques, documents and other instruments;

(d) the keeping and custody of minutes of proceedings at meetings;

(e) the custody of the common seal; and

(f) the procedure for transaction of business by any committee of the Board.
